There are a couple of important tips to note. For one, you want your cream cheese softened, but your crescent rolls straight out of the fridge. The crescent rolls are easier to work with if they are cold. If they have set out for a bit, they get a little cantankerous. And no one wants to deal with a cantankerous crescent roll! lol I usually get the first tube out and lay the bottom “crust” down. After I have mixed up all my filling ingredients and spread them out, then I get the second tube of crescent rolls out. Trust me. Do it this way. Another thing you will want to take note of is that you want to lightly brush your egg whites on your top layer. If you put it on with a heavy hand, it does not turn out as well. Again, trust me.

Ingredients

  • 16 oz cans crescent rolls (2 – 8 oz tubes)
  • 16 oz blocks cream cheese (2 – 8 oz blocks)
  • 3/4 cup sugar plus more for sprinkling on top
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 egg divided
  • 21 oz peach pie filling

Instructions

  • Unroll one can of crescent rolls in the bottom of a slightly greased 6-quart crock pot.
  • Mix together your cream cheese, sugar, vanilla and egg yolk (reserve your egg white) with a mixer until well blended and smooth
  • Spread your cream cheese mixture evenly across your crescent rolls
  • Top with your peach pie filling and spread out evenly
  • Top with your other can of crescent rolls
  • Brush the top of your crescent rolls with egg whites and sprinkle with sugar
  • Place a couple of paper towels under the lid, cover and cook on high for 4-6 hours
  • Serve warm and refrigerate leftovers

Notes

  • You want to keep your crescent rolls in the fridge until you are ready to use them. They are easier to roll out when they are cold.
  • Donโ€™t use too much of your egg whites. Just lightly brush them on the top.
